Output 2cdd31d2f5cc3e8f9b272e30763c241a8ddb8ba7801a00143e19e64eb10ac005:6

value
163303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abf367fc57b113e501336dbee49e6bec23ef9550 OP_EQUAL
address
3HND4WH9ov5GGpAqvDY1RjntAQk7sRTyLA
transaction
2cdd31d2f5cc3e8f9b272e30763c241a8ddb8ba7801a00143e19e64eb10ac005
spent
true